Treatment Cost
The table below provides indicative market cost ranges for fertility and reproductive treatments in Chennai. Exact expenses vary based on clinical protocols, diagnostic findings, and individual patient requirements.
| Treatment Type | Indicative Cost Range (INR) |
|---|---|
| Intrauterine Insemination (IUI) | Rs. 10,000 - Rs. 20,000 per cycle |
| In Vitro Fertilisation (IVF) | Rs. 1,25,000 - Rs. 2,25,000 per cycle |
| Intracytoplasmic Sperm Injection (ICSI) | Rs. 1,40,000 - Rs. 2,50,000 per cycle |
| Embryo Cryopreservation (1 Year) | Rs. 30,000 - Rs. 50,000 |
| Laser Assisted Hatching | Rs. 15,000 - Rs. 25,000 |
| Diagnostic / Operative Laparoscopy | Rs. 45,000 - Rs. 85,000 |
| Gestational Surrogacy (Complete Program) | Rs. 11,00,000 - Rs. 16,00,000 |
Disclaimer: The costs listed above represent broad Chennai market estimates and do not reflect specific clinic tariffs. Total expenses depend on individual medical history, required medications, and laboratory procedures.

Frequently Asked Questions
Who is typically considered eligible for IVF treatments in Chennai?
IVF is generally recommended for individuals and couples experiencing blocked or damaged fallopian tubes, severe male-factor infertility, ovulation dysfunction like PCOS, advanced maternal age, or unexplained infertility where less invasive approaches such as IUI have not succeeded. A comprehensive reproductive workup determines clinical readiness.
How do fertility medications and injections work during an IVF cycle?
Ovarian stimulation relies on hormone injections administered over 8 to 12 days to encourage multiple follicles to mature simultaneously. Regular blood monitoring and ultrasounds ensure safety and precise timing for egg retrieval.
What factors influence IVF success rates for couples in Purasaiwakkam, Chennai?
Key factors that directly impact IVF success include female age, ovarian reserve, sperm quality, uterine receptivity, embryo genetic health, and underlying health factors such as thyroid disorders or diabetes. Leading fertility centres leverage advanced lab technology and tailored protocols to give patients the strongest chance of a healthy pregnancy.
What are the primary stages of a gestational surrogacy journey in Chennai?
A surrogacy journey generally begins with clinical assessments of the intended parents, creation of embryos via IVF, identification and thorough medical screening of a gestational surrogate, embryo transfer, and comprehensive prenatal monitoring through delivery. What should couples evaluate when choosing a fertility centre in Chennai?
Couples should assess the experience and qualifications of the reproductive specialists, the technical capabilities of the embryology laboratory (such as cryopreservation and ICSI), transparency around procedure costs, proximity to home or work, and patient feedback. A clinic that emphasizes customized treatment plans over one-size-fits-all options usually provides better patient support.
